Vitamin C and Immune Support

Loquats naturally contain vitamin C, an essential nutrient involved in many important body functions.

Vitamin C helps support:

  • Immune system function
  • Collagen production
  • Skin health
  • Cell protection

Because the body cannot store large amounts of vitamin C, regularly consuming fruits and vegetables containing it is important.

Potassium and Everyday Wellness

Another useful nutrient found in loquats is potassium.

Potassium contributes to:

  • Muscle function
  • Fluid balance
  • Nerve signaling
  • Normal blood pressure regulation

Many people do not consume enough potassium-rich foods, making fruits like loquats a helpful addition to varied diets.

Minerals Found in Loquats

Loquats also provide smaller amounts of minerals such as:

  • Iron
  • Copper
  • Calcium
  • Manganese

These minerals contribute to numerous biological processes inside the body.

For example:

  • Iron helps transport oxygen through the blood
  • Copper supports red blood cell production
  • Calcium contributes to bone health
  • Manganese supports metabolism and antioxidant functions

Can Loquats Prevent Cancer?

Some articles online make very strong claims about loquats “preventing cancer.”

While antioxidant-rich fruits are associated with overall healthy diets, no single fruit can guarantee cancer prevention.

Research generally supports eating a variety of fruits and vegetables because diets rich in plant foods may help support long-term health.

But medical experts caution against treating any single food as a miracle cure.

How People Commonly Eat Loquats

Loquats are enjoyed in many simple ways.

Popular serving ideas include:

  • Fresh and chilled
  • In fruit salads
  • Blended into smoothies
  • Made into jam
  • Used in desserts

Before eating, the large seeds should always be removed.

The seeds are not edible and should not be consumed.
